Description
The TMP75 and TMP175 devices are digital temperature sensors ideal for negative temperature coefficient NTC and positive temperature coefficient PTC thermistor replacement. The devices offer a typical accuracy of ±1°C without requiring calibration or external component signal conditioning. Device temperature sensors are highly linear and do not require complex calculations or look-up tables to derive the temperature. The on-chip 12-bit analog-to digital converter ADC offers resolutions down to 0.0625°C. The devices are available in the industry standard LM75 SOIC-8 and MSOP-8 footprint.
Features
• TMP175: 27 Addresses
• TMP75: 8 Addresses, NIST Traceable
• Digital Output: SMBus™, Two-Wire, and I2C Interface Compatibility
• Resolution: 9 to 12 Bits, User-Selectable
• Accuracy:
– ±1°C Typical from −40°C to +125°C
– ±2°C Maximum from −40°C to +125°C
• Low Quiescent Current: 50-μA, 0.1-μA Standby
• Wide Supply Range: 2.7 V to 5.5 V
• Small 8-Pin MSOP and 8-Pin SOIC Packages
Applications
• Power-Supply Temperature Monitoring
• Computer Peripheral Thermal Protection
• Notebook Computers
• Cell Phones
• Battery Management
• Office Machines
• Thermostat Controls
• Environmental Monitoring and HVAC
• Electro Mechanical Device Temperature
